summaryrefslogtreecommitdiff
path: root/2.3-1/demos/Brijesh_Demos
diff options
context:
space:
mode:
authorBrijeshcr2017-08-18 16:29:50 +0530
committerBrijeshcr2017-08-18 16:29:50 +0530
commit857169357d49e44275e589c42653c1a00d4b0c82 (patch)
treecfe1914c73665fc2ae65e8eb97a61c4951adcb84 /2.3-1/demos/Brijesh_Demos
parentdcfc88991cdfa7f8e53607094e8d26cae399b78e (diff)
downloadScilab2C-857169357d49e44275e589c42653c1a00d4b0c82.tar.gz
Scilab2C-857169357d49e44275e589c42653c1a00d4b0c82.tar.bz2
Scilab2C-857169357d49e44275e589c42653c1a00d4b0c82.zip
Scaling and Log2 added
Diffstat (limited to '2.3-1/demos/Brijesh_Demos')
-rw-r--r--2.3-1/demos/Brijesh_Demos/test_log2.sci14
-rw-r--r--2.3-1/demos/Brijesh_Demos/test_lu.sci11
-rw-r--r--2.3-1/demos/Brijesh_Demos/test_scaling.sci15
3 files changed, 40 insertions, 0 deletions
diff --git a/2.3-1/demos/Brijesh_Demos/test_log2.sci b/2.3-1/demos/Brijesh_Demos/test_log2.sci
new file mode 100644
index 00000000..bd1288b2
--- /dev/null
+++ b/2.3-1/demos/Brijesh_Demos/test_log2.sci
@@ -0,0 +1,14 @@
+function test_log2
+ disp('Datatype: Double');
+ i1 = [1 2 3; 4 5 6];
+ o1 = log2(i1);
+ disp(o1);
+ disp('Datatype: float');
+ i2 = float([1 2 3; 4 5 6]);
+ o2 = log2(i2);
+ disp(o2);
+ disp('Datatype: Double Complex');
+ i3 = [5*%i+6, 3; 1 %i];
+ o3 = log2(i3);
+ disp(o3);
+endfunction
diff --git a/2.3-1/demos/Brijesh_Demos/test_lu.sci b/2.3-1/demos/Brijesh_Demos/test_lu.sci
new file mode 100644
index 00000000..aa7c2013
--- /dev/null
+++ b/2.3-1/demos/Brijesh_Demos/test_lu.sci
@@ -0,0 +1,11 @@
+function test_lu
+ disp('Datatype: Double');
+ i1 = [1 2 ;3 4 ;5 6;3 4 ;5 6; 7 8];
+ [o1, o2] = lu(i1);
+ disp(o1);
+ disp(o2);
+ //disp('Datatype: float');
+ //i2 = float([1 2 3; 4 5 6]);
+ //o2 = gamma(i2);
+ //disp(o2);
+endfunction
diff --git a/2.3-1/demos/Brijesh_Demos/test_scaling.sci b/2.3-1/demos/Brijesh_Demos/test_scaling.sci
new file mode 100644
index 00000000..19aa7f4c
--- /dev/null
+++ b/2.3-1/demos/Brijesh_Demos/test_scaling.sci
@@ -0,0 +1,15 @@
+function test_scaling
+ disp("Data Type: Double");
+ i1 = [1 2 3; 4 5 6];
+ i2 = [5 5];
+ o1 = scaling(i1, 10, i2);
+ disp(o1);
+ disp("Data Type: Float");
+ o2 = scaling(float(i1), 10, float(i2));
+ disp(o2);
+ disp("Data Type: Double Complex");
+ i3 = [1 2+%i %i*3; 4 0 6];
+ i4 = [5*%i 0];
+ o3 = scaling(i3, %i, i4);
+ disp(o3);
+endfunction